With the changes made to your truck, I would suggest you physically bolt a wheel on that you know the actual measurements of & work from there.

You should be able to put a truck ralley (steel wheel) on & take some measurements where things are relative (suspension vs. sheetmetal). Add an inch here or there to arrive @ what works for your combo. I use stuff like pieces of wood taped to the wheek/tire to determine additional clearances required.
